Acceleration Wheel Sensor Unavailable

My car needs an acceleration sensor for the front Left wheel. Mercedes Dealer cannot source one locally/nationally. Dealer attempted to purchase from MB HQ. HQ does not have any. It has escalated to the point where Mercedes now have to manufacture more sensors...so I can get one. Seems kinda unbelievable, but it is what it is. I have not been given a timeframe.

My question is, has something similar happened to anyone else and how long did it take to resolve? Annoyed cause one of the America's largest vintage racing events is occurring in my city with one of the largest car shows...next week
